Pricing

Log inSign up
  • Flo-Mech Ltd

  • HQ

HQ

Description

Flo-Mech Ltd's headquarters in Peterborough, United Kingdom


People (8)

Andrew Elderkin

Sales Director

Robin Cattermole

Engineering Director

MH

Martyn Henson

Sales Manager

Steve Lovell

Sales Manager

Dan Lowder

Engineering Manager

MC

Miguel Castro

Senior Project Manager / Engineer

Timothy Spenceley

Innovation Manager

Ross Penman

Sales Engineering Manager


Jobs

No jobs in this office

Company
AboutContactBlog
Product
LearnExploreIterate
Business
SolutionsTrustPricing
Enrich
Browser ExtensionCRM EnrichmentDeveloper Portal
Social
© 2025 Orgio, Inc.
Terms
Privacy
Do not sell my info